Candidate must be able to work a flexible schedule of:

(7:00AM to 3:30PM) Monday through Friday

A successful candidate has:

  • 1-2 years in a shop or maintenance environment preferred
  • Exceptional organizational & communication skills
  • High attention to detail
  • Able to lift up to 50 lbs. to physically move stock in the facility
  • Experience with Microsoft office applications and the ability to type proficiently

Responsibilities include:

  • Administrative duties to support the location’s Shop Manager
  • Sort, review, organize and file various documentation (i.e preventative maintenance forms, invoices, printed emails, employee files)
  • Utilize company software to order, review, send, receive and track parts in inventory as well as the ability to review mechanic’s repair orders for accurate part disposition daily.
  • Create, keep, and remind shop management of appointments and other priorities/tasks
  • Answer phone calls to handle the issues, find the appropriate person to handle the issue or take a message and follow up.
  • Communicate daily with shop leads to monitor timelines on projects/repairs.
